**Key Developments**
Tokensave 0.1.3 introduces three core improvements. First, a refined encryption module now uses a hybrid approach—combining elliptic‑curve cryptography with lightweight hash functions—to protect private keys even when devices are compromised. Second, the update streamlines the way large language model (LLM) requests are packaged. By collapsing redundant context into a single import statement, the software reduces the token count per API call by up to 40%, which lowers latency and cuts costs for users who rely on AI‑driven analytics tools. Third, a new audit log feature gives users transparent, immutable records of every security‑relevant action, making it easier to spot anomalous activity in real time.
